Personal statement/scientific interests
I have an extensive experience in the study of post-transcriptional regulation of gene expression and how it impinges on key physiological and pathological conditions, including cancer. In this respect, I contributed seminal work on how changes in expression/activity of splicing factors influence the alternative splicing (AS) of cancer-associated genes and directly promote tumor progression. For the first time, I demonstrated a direct link between AS modulation and regulation of cell motility, a process with crucial implications in embryogenesis, tissue formation and tumor metastasis (Ref. 33). In addition, I provided fundamental knowledge concerning the AS control of epithelial–mesenchymal transition, which is crucial for the formation of metastases, and its integration with signaling pathways (28, 26). Importantly, I also used the knowledge gained through these studies to target cancer-specific AS variants as possible anti-cancer strategy (Ref. 29). More recently, I elucidated the molecular mechanisms through which AS plays a role in angiogenesis and in tumor vasculature (15, 12, 10, 2). Also, I am interested in the role of RNA binding proteins (RBPs) in neurodegenerative diseases (such as amyotrophic lateral sclerosis).
